Zamboanga processes 8,217 business registrations, renewals

A TOTAL of 8,217 applications for business registration and renewal were assessed and processed by the Business One Stop Shop (BOSS) at Centro Latino Convention Center in Paseo del Mar from January 3 to 20, the period for filing designated by law.

City Licensing Division Chief Benjie Barredo said that 7,937 of the 8,217 applications submitted are renewal while 280 are new business applications.

Barredo said that over 500 applications were filed and received by the BOSS for January 20 alone, the last day of filing.

These applications will be processed during weekend and the remaining working days of January, according to Barredo.

He said that the City Treasurer’s Office has extended the payment hours up to 10 p.m., Friday, January 20.

It is recalled that the City Council in a special session last Thursday, January 19, has approved an ordinance extending the deadline for the payment of business tax to January 31.

The BOSS is a system where all offices and agencies involve in the business registration and renewal processes are housed at the Centro Latino Convention Center.

From January 3 to 20, the BOSS operated from 8 a.m. to 8 p.m. during weekdays and from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m. during weekends.

Barredo said BOSS will continue to operate at Centro Latino Convention Center until the end of January to process applications submitted from January 3 to 20.

He said that renewal applications submitted after January 20 will be subjected to the surcharges and penalties. (SunStar Philippines)
